Bukit Damansara — also known as Damansara Heights — is one of Kuala Lumpur’s most exclusive and sought-after addresses. Often dubbed the “Beverly Hills of Malaysia,” this neighbourhood has long been associated with luxury bungalows, political elites, and old money.
But beyond the big houses and private roads, Bukit Damansara is changing.
Once known for being a quiet, residential enclave, the area now blends tradition with modern touches. New developments like Pavilion Damansara Heights and Damansara City Mall bring upscale retail, office spaces, and fine dining to the area. Even Tesla Malaysia chose this neighbourhood to open its second showroom, outside of its HQ in Cyberjaya — a move that signals how the area is adapting to modern luxury and tech-forward living.
🚆 MRT Connectivity Makes a Difference
Bukit Damansara was once a place you could only drive to. But that’s no longer the case.
With two MRT stations now serving the area — Semantan and Pusat Bandar Damansara — getting in and out is easier than ever. Whether you’re commuting to Kuala Lumpur or heading out to Petaling Jaya or Mont Kiara, it’s all more accessible.
🏘️ Where Old Charm Meets New Vibes
Despite the rise of modern malls and trendy cafés, the core of Bukit Damansara stays the same.
Quiet streets lined with bungalows, lots of greenery, and a strong sense of exclusivity still define the area.
